/**
* Tests of @Indexed and @Unindexed
*
* @author Scott Hernandez
* @author Jeff Schnitzer
*/
public class IndexingEmbeddedTests extends TestBase
{
/** */
@SuppressWarnings("unused")
private static Logger log = Logger.getLogger(IndexingEmbeddedTests.class.getName());
@Indexed
public static class LevelTwoIndexedClass
{
String bar="A";
}
public static class LevelTwoIndexedField
{
@Indexed String bar="A";
}
public static class LevelOne {
String foo = "1";
@Embedded LevelTwoIndexedClass twoClass = new LevelTwoIndexedClass();
@Embedded LevelTwoIndexedField twoField = new LevelTwoIndexedField();
}
@Entity @Unindexed
public static class EntityWithEmbedded {
@Id Long id;
@Embedded LevelOne one = new LevelOne();
String prop = "A";
}
@SuppressWarnings("unused")
public static class EmbeddedIndexedPojo
{
@Id Long id;
@Unindexed private boolean aProp = true;
@Indexed @Embedded private IndexedDefaultPojo[] indexed = {new IndexedDefaultPojo()};
@Unindexed @Embedded private IndexedDefaultPojo[] unindexed = {new IndexedDefaultPojo()};
@Embedded private IndexedDefaultPojo[] def = {new IndexedDefaultPojo()};
// Fundamentally broken; how to test bad-hetro behavior?
// @Indexed @Embedded private List indexedHetro = new ArrayList();
// @Unindexed @Embedded private List unindexedHetro = new ArrayList();
// @Embedded private List defHetro = new ArrayList();
// public EmbeddedIndexedPojo(){
// indexedHetro.add(new IndexedDefaultPojo());
// indexedHetro.add(new IndexedPojo());
//
// unindexedHetro.addAll(indexedHetro);
// defHetro.addAll(indexedHetro);
// }
}
/** */
@BeforeMethod
public void setUp()
{
super.setUp();
this.fact.register(IndexedDefaultPojo.class);
this.fact.register(EmbeddedIndexedPojo.class);
this.fact.register(EntityWithEmbedded.class);
}
/** */
@Test
public void testEmbeddedIndexedPojo() throws Exception
{
Objectify ofy = this.fact.begin();
ofy.put(new EmbeddedIndexedPojo());
assert ofy.query(EmbeddedIndexedPojo.class).filter("indexed.indexed =", true).iterator().hasNext();
assert ofy.query(EmbeddedIndexedPojo.class).filter("indexed.def =", true).iterator().hasNext();
assert !ofy.query(EmbeddedIndexedPojo.class).filter("indexed.unindexed=", true).iterator().hasNext();
assert ofy.query(EmbeddedIndexedPojo.class).filter("def.indexed =", true).iterator().hasNext();
assert !ofy.query(EmbeddedIndexedPojo.class).filter("def.unindexed =", true).iterator().hasNext();
assert ofy.query(EmbeddedIndexedPojo.class).filter("def.def =", true).iterator().hasNext();
assert !ofy.query(EmbeddedIndexedPojo.class).filter("unindexed.unindexed =", true).iterator().hasNext();
assert ofy.query(EmbeddedIndexedPojo.class).filter("unindexed.indexed =", true).iterator().hasNext();
assert !ofy.query(EmbeddedIndexedPojo.class).filter("unindexed.def =", true).iterator().hasNext();
}
/** */
@Test
public void testEmbeddedGraph() throws Exception
{
/*
* one.twoClass.bar = "A"
* one.twoField.bar = "A"
* one.foo = "1"
* id = ?
* prop = "A"
*/
Objectify ofy = this.fact.begin();
ofy.put(new EntityWithEmbedded());
assert !ofy.query(EntityWithEmbedded.class).filter("prop =", "A").iterator().hasNext();
assert !ofy.query(EntityWithEmbedded.class).filter("one.foo =", "1").iterator().hasNext();
assert ofy.query(EntityWithEmbedded.class).filter("one.twoClass.bar =", "A").iterator().hasNext();
assert ofy.query(EntityWithEmbedded.class).filter("one.twoField.bar =", "A").iterator().hasNext();
}
}
